Tools for Shared Contextual Understanding[edit source]

One of the suggestions was that the whole learning process (course, module), including the community interaction could be seen as part of the "game of life" we all play all the time. The difference is that we have Web 2.0 and other tools to help us share knowledge, make decisions and assess performance, etc. - and most importantly, make learning a fun social collaborative game.

The list below comprises links to existing facilities/tools which support the collaborative activities of students of social entrepreneurship. The tools help the learners make sense of the contexts they find themselves in. Students also learn to use available Internet facilities for professional and social life in the 21st century.
